xmas song stream : Lizarella Phones Home

11 months ago
17

Lizarella is a human being from outer space. She didn’t know Earth was still inhabited, since she was taught everyone died except her heroic billionaire ancestors who escaped just in time. Now she’s woke, and back in the home atmosphere, calling YOU from her ship and asking: What do you think is Out There?

Loading comments...